Welcome to on-call for the Glimmerpane design system! Our snapshot tests live in the `snapcheck` suite and run on every merge to main. If a UI component changes visually, the diff bot flags it — usually it's an intentional tweak, so just approve the new baseline. If it's 2am and snapshots are failing across the board, it's almost always a font-loading race, not your problem. To unlock the baseline store and re-approve snapshots in bulk, use the recovery passphrase below.

recovery phrase for tahag-taguf: wenix-caswyn

Subject: Dedup pass on customer records — what support should expect

Hi all, tonight's Mergewell run will collapse duplicate customer records sharing a verified contact match. Merged records keep the oldest creation date; order history is combined. If a customer reports missing data, check the merge log first. The run is tied to the build identifier noted below.

pipeline stamp: htk6_44d6a0

Subject: Partner SFTP drop — new owner

Hi,

As you review the pending changes to the Harborline ingest scripts, note that ownership of the partner SFTP drop is changing at the end of the month. This includes key rotation, the nightly pull job, and the quarantine folder for malformed files. Review comments on the retry logic should still go through the normal PR flow, but questions about drop-folder conventions or partner onboarding now go to the new owner. The incoming owner is listed below.

signatory, tagaf-bahaf: Praael Fenmir Rusok

Subject: Marketing Budget Reduction — Immediate

Executive team,

Effective next quarter, marketing spend at Veldane Group is cut 22%. Brand campaigns for the Orelia line pause; performance channels continue at reduced pace. Savings redirect to the Calvett integration. Department heads submit revised plans by Friday. No exceptions without my sign-off. Questions to Marta Hellqvist before the board session in Draymoor.

The reasoning behind this reallocation is set out in the confidential note below.

management briefing: Project Ulavan slips by two quarters because of the staffing delay.